Friday, July 1, 2016 #PreMarket Comments by Michael Blythe
Good morning. First day of a new month/quarter tends to lean toward buying, but after a 5% S&P 500 rally from the Monday lows, it’s difficult to balance between what *may* amount to profit taking to close the week and the strong trend which shows no weakness at the moment. So at this point the bias is neutral.
My intentions for the day are simple. The 8:30 CST cash open, above that price I intend to be a buyer only, below the open I could do anything, however since Monday the ESU6 has not seen much action below the RTH opening print.
Downside prices are 2088 (**) which I see as a very good early indicator, followed by 2085 (**) and then 2081 (*). Below 2080 the path to 2075 appears to be very clear of technical debris. To the upside, 2092 (*), 2100 (**) and 2120 (***) are all that has my attention.
Worth noting that It is the Friday before a three day holiday, can’t close the door on it being a quiet day, even though it’s first of the month. After all, a considerable amount of buy power has been used this week.

Thursday, June 30, 2016 #PreMarket Comments by Michael Blythe
Good morning. Impressive resilience by global equities with a continued (but weaker) bid overnight. At this point convictions are likely useless. I bought some lotto puts into the close yesterday (mentioned in the room) from a pure risk/reward viewpoint as a 85 handle rally *seemed* excessive without any pullback.
For bears, they need for the ESU6 lower high in the European session to help push back through the 2056 Globex low and maybe with the quarter end trade, there could be some push back to 2050 (at least)
Bulls, just need a higher low, which gives them a lot of room at this point, price could retrace back to 2040 and bulls be theoretically OK.
Today I’ll be simple. If price is above the cash open then I will only be long, if below the open then I will lean short but be open to buying because for the moment, it is a buyers market.
Levels to the downside are 2062 (**) and 2056 (*). Below 2056 I don’t have anything until 2045 (*). Upside interest is 2067 (*) which I will use as an early risk marker then 2075 (*) followed by 2080 (***) area which I would expect to see considerable resistance.

Wednesday, June 29, 2016 #PreMarket Comments by Michael Blythe
Good morning. Another run higher for global equities last night that helped the ESU6 push up to 2043.50. The mini is now over 60 handles from Monday’s low and 2050 roughly marks the halfway point from last weeks’s high to Monday’s low. I have a difficult time assuming that equities will make a V-shape recovery and expect at least somewhat of a retest of this weeks lows (at some point) while forcing bulls to make a lower high on the daily chart. Having said this, I am still in a macro sell the rallies mode until 2050-2060 proves support. To me, the risk/reward looks favorable for some lotto type puts and I am starting to price week 1 and week 2 options.
Price levels to the downside are: 2032 (**) 2028 (**) 2023 (*) 2019(*) 2014 (***)
Upside prices: 2050 (**) 2054 (**) 2060 (**) and 2064 (***)
For me, 2041 is the pivotal price heading into the cash open and I lean to trading with whomever controls that area.
